PART 2Consequential Amendments to Secondary Legislation

Estate Agents (Undesirable Practices) (No 2) Order 1991

12.  Schedule 3 (other matters) to the Estate Agents (Undesirable Practices) (No 2) Order 1991(1) is amended as follows—

(a)at the beginning of paragraph 2, insert “Subject to paragraph 2A”;

(b)after paragraph 2, insert—

2A.  Paragraph 2 does not apply if the estate agent does not forward accurate details of the offer because the estate agent is unable to apply the customer due diligence measures required by regulation 28, and where relevant, those required by regulations 33, and 35 to 37 of the Money Laundering, Terrorist Financing and Transfer of Funds (Information on the Payer) Regulations 2017 in relation to the offeror..

Open-Ended Investment Companies Regulations 2001

18.  Regulation 48 (bearer shares) of the Open-Ended Investment Companies Regulations 2001(8) is amended as follows—

(a)the existing text is renumbered as paragraph (1);

(b)in that paragraph (1), after “investment company” insert “authorised before the day on which the Money Laundering, Terrorist Financing and Transfer of Funds (Information on the Payer) Regulations 2017 came into force (“the relevant date”)”;

(c)after paragraph (1) insert—

(2) An open-ended investment company authorised on or after the relevant date may not issue any bearer shares under paragraph (1), and any provision in the instrument of incorporation of such an open-ended investment company purporting to authorise it to do so is void.

(3) Paragraph (2) does not apply to an open-ended investment company if—

(a)an application for an authorisation order was made in relation to that open-ended investment company before the relevant date; and

(b)that application was not determined until a date on or after the relevant date..
